Out of 55 thousand people, 300 of the strongest participants made it to the final of the 21st season of the all-Russian competition My Country – My Russia, a project of the presidential platform Russia is the Country of Opportunities, including five residents of the Krasnoyarsk region.
The contestants’ works were assessed by three thousand experts from all the country regions.
Five participants from the Krasnoyarsk region made it to the final, including Vera Nikolayeva, a student of the Norilsk pedagogical college.
Vera Nikolayeva presented the project Study of the Taimyr Atmospheric Air State Using the Lichen Indication Method.
“Vera and I have been working on the topic of Taimyr ecology for the fifth year now. Before we started studying lichens, we conducted water and soil research, and now we decided to turn to lichens, because they are the best indicator of air purity”, said the student’s scientific supervisor, natural science teacher, and candidate of psychological sciences Larisa Andreyeva.
It should be noted that Larisa Andreyeva’s students have won regional and federal competitions more than once. And this time, the teacher did not hide her pride that her joint work with Vera was appreciated.
“It’s nice to be in the top ten out of such a huge number of applicants. On December 1, we will have an online defense, and we hope for success!” concluded Larisa Andreyeva.
